  • Title

    Deriving test procedures of Low-Rate Wireless Personal Area Networks

  • Abstract
    Low-Rate Wireless Personal Area Network (LRWPAN) technologies are more widely applied in industrial applications, posing additional challenges for reliability due to harsh conditions. Efficient and manageable testing methods and tools to support building and maintaining reliable communication are inevitable though currently not so well existing. The goal of our work is to derive a systematic approach for testing LR-WPANs applicable in different contexts like operational and commissioning use. We define a set of faults and disturbances and a set of metrics indicating impacts of these. Further on we define Test Procedures for deriving specific targeted test sequences for detecting specific faults and disturbances, like detecting device failures or harsh traffic conditions. We also present some test examples and measurement results from field tests.
